Two individuals died when a US military AH-64 Apache helicopter crashed in central Texas. The incident occurred near Salado, prompting emergency services to respond to the wreckage and a spreading fire. The identities of the victims remain undisclosed. The US Army confirmed the helicopter was stationed at Fort Hood and is investigating the crash's circumstances. Brigadier General Ethan Diven emphasized securing the area and supporting initial response operations. The Apache helicopter is known for its combat capabilities and is used by both the US and allied forces. Investigators will determine if technical failure, human error, or other factors caused the accident.
